Freeman Township is one of nineteen current townships in Pope County, Arkansas, USA.[1] As of the 2000 census, its unincorporated population was 98.
Geography
According to the United States Census Bureau, Freeman Township covers an area of 119.8 square miles (310 km2); all of this land.
